Output ea123a308d666462b976fc12c9386a049a53e5cd18318cb2b1d96b4511ff967e:26

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3a20c791a03a6c84a96a448659595382a787b9ceda97157dd0bd0e1f226de55e
address
tb1p8gsv0ydq8fkgf2t2gjr9jk2ns2nc0wwwm2t32lwsh58p7gndu40q3ajx7a
transaction
ea123a308d666462b976fc12c9386a049a53e5cd18318cb2b1d96b4511ff967e